David Humphrey (:humph) david.humphrey@senecacollege.ca
29549a2dc5
Fix https://github.com/mozilla/thimble.webmaker.org/issues/674 - remove items from file tree context menu
2015-07-13 14:14:41 -04:00
David Humphrey (:humph) david.humphrey@senecacollege.ca
c49e177a29
Autosave after 5s vs. 30s of making an editor dirty
2015-07-13 12:03:41 -04:00
David Humphrey (:humph) david.humphrey@senecacollege.ca
5bf8a0cd13
Add backend support for word wrap - https://github.com/mozilla/thimble.webmaker.org/issues/648
2015-07-13 11:59:08 -04:00
David Humphrey (:humph) david.humphrey@senecacollege.ca
ec76aed8f0
Don't wait on focus for Brackets commands that don't require it (e.g., saveAll)
2015-07-13 11:31:31 -04:00
Gideon Thomas
2a8989309d
Merge pull request #379 from gideonthomas/fixType
...
Fix typo for in HTMLRewriter
2015-07-06 12:21:07 -04:00
Gideon Thomas
8e3437e642
Fix typo for in HTMLRewriter
2015-07-06 12:12:20 -04:00
David Humphrey (:humph) david.humphrey@senecacollege.ca
de5842fa7c
Fix https://github.com/mozilla/thimble.webmaker.org/issues/635 - proper resize code for sidebar on startup
2015-07-06 10:51:16 -04:00
David Humphrey (:humph) david.humphrey@senecacollege.ca
8e204d52b6
Allow SVG to be treated as an image or XML doc in ImageViewer, with extension to override
2015-07-06 10:49:56 -04:00
David Humphrey (:humph) david.humphrey@senecacollege.ca
614a955e80
Fix #372 - add optional callbacks for all remote bramble instance methods
2015-07-06 10:28:37 -04:00
David Humphrey (:humph) david.humphrey@senecacollege.ca
598f300eb6
Fix https://github.com/mozilla/thimble.webmaker.org/issues/639 - add cursor:pointer to files in file tray
2015-07-06 10:16:46 -04:00
Gideon Thomas
25d02b2528
Merge pull request #373 from humphd/thimble-issue633
...
Fix https://github.com/mozilla/thimble.webmaker.org/issues/633 - teach HTMLServer, HTMLRewriter about CSS Live Docs
2015-07-06 10:01:59 -04:00
David Humphrey (:humph) david.humphrey@senecacollege.ca
548a5ef8ad
Fix https://github.com/mozilla/thimble.webmaker.org/issues/633 - teach HTMLServer, HTMLRewriter about CSS Live Docs
2015-07-02 13:56:40 -04:00
David Humphrey
922b3a0353
Merge pull request #371 from humphd/thimble620
...
Fix https://github.com/mozilla/thimble.webmaker.org/issues/620 - Remember last-open-file within subdirs
2015-06-29 15:53:19 -04:00
David Humphrey (:humph) david.humphrey@senecacollege.ca
efcc4af140
Fix https://github.com/mozilla/thimble.webmaker.org/issues/620 - Remember last-open-file within subdirs
2015-06-29 15:35:44 -04:00
David Humphrey (:humph) david.humphrey@senecacollege.ca
9fe83ec88c
[nobug] Update Filer submodule for https://github.com/filerjs/filer/pull/359
2015-06-29 13:07:17 -04:00
David Humphrey (:humph) david.humphrey@senecacollege.ca
486ba1d7de
Fix #306 - Support importing .zip archives
2015-06-26 16:15:53 -04:00
David Humphrey
079e94eb57
Merge pull request #369 from humphd/issue367
...
Fix #367 - Resize only works when you've first moved the divider
2015-06-25 15:33:39 -04:00
David Humphrey
62efd9b075
Fix #367 - Resize only works when you've first moved the divider
2015-06-25 14:53:50 -04:00
Jordan Theriault
06de738430
Merge pull request #366 from JordanTheriault/filetreeUI
...
Initial re-theme overrides to brackets filetree
2015-06-25 10:42:26 -04:00
JordanTheriault
224ea83f94
Initial retheme overrides to brackets filetree.
2015-06-25 10:22:31 -04:00
Jordan Theriault
2d99d8a102
Merge pull request #365 from JordanTheriault/mobileViewBackgroundFix
...
FIX: Keep bg of mobile view white even in dark mode
2015-06-24 14:38:46 -04:00
JordanTheriault
282a03247b
FIX: Keep bg of mobile view white even in dark mode
2015-06-24 14:27:28 -04:00
David Humphrey (:humph) david.humphrey@senecacollege.ca
a001335a87
Fix #357 : Reload preview when files are deleted and renamed
2015-06-24 11:31:10 -04:00
David Humphrey
82433a0fd0
Merge pull request #364 from humphd/thimble-issue590-followup
...
Don't warn if theme or preview mode are null
2015-06-24 11:30:35 -04:00
David Humphrey (:humph) david.humphrey@senecacollege.ca
f3473a3d7a
Don't warn if theme or preview mode are null
2015-06-24 11:28:44 -04:00
David Humphrey
f579baf07e
Merge pull request #362 from humphd/thimble-issue590
...
Remember state between sessions
2015-06-24 11:26:00 -04:00
David Humphrey (:humph) david.humphrey@senecacollege.ca
78bbefebc0
Remember state between sessions
2015-06-24 10:56:03 -04:00
Jordan Theriault
2859b1814d
Merge pull request #361 from JordanTheriault/lineheightFix
...
Removed line height override in light theme
2015-06-24 10:17:38 -04:00
JordanTheriault
c233cd9c8c
Removed line height override in light theme
2015-06-24 10:15:11 -04:00
David Humphrey
b73ec43610
Merge pull request #363 from humphd/resize-iframe
...
Resize iframe contents when host window resizes
2015-06-24 09:35:32 -04:00
David Humphrey (:humph) david.humphrey@senecacollege.ca
85ad6b6664
Resize iframe contents when host window resizes
2015-06-23 16:30:17 -04:00
Jordan Theriault
19704a1268
Merge pull request #360 from JordanTheriault/themeUpdate
...
Changed themes to use less files in extensions/bramble/stylesheets directory
2015-06-22 18:05:01 -04:00
JordanTheriault
d37d05510d
Changed themes to use less files in extensions/bramble/stylesheets directory
2015-06-22 17:35:04 -04:00
David Humphrey
2638fef6d7
Merge pull request #358 from humphd/double-firing-ready
...
Don't double-fire bramble:loaded, and Bramble ready event
2015-06-22 13:23:07 -04:00
David Humphrey (:humph) david.humphrey@senecacollege.ca
ac57a6c782
Don't double-fire bramble:loaded, and Bramble ready event
2015-06-22 13:18:58 -04:00
David Humphrey
364aac5857
Merge pull request #356 from humphd/fix-compatibility-loading-in-ie
...
Revert change to how Brackets gets loaded, so that utils/Compatibility is done first for IE
2015-06-22 12:10:06 -04:00
David Humphrey (:humph) david.humphrey@senecacollege.ca
5fc677b5c3
Revert change to how Brackets gets loaded, so that utils/Compatibility is done first for IE
2015-06-22 11:56:30 -04:00
David Humphrey (:humph) david.humphrey@senecacollege.ca
331b5a227d
Fix #352 : deal with encoded paths, preload blob urls, fix fs bugs
2015-06-22 10:47:45 -04:00
David Humphrey (:humph) david.humphrey@senecacollege.ca
b9c4b26d21
Fix https://github.com/mozilla/thimble.webmaker.org/issues/577 - change default font size to 15px
2015-06-19 10:00:25 -04:00
David Humphrey (:humph) david.humphrey@senecacollege.ca
a49eae0104
[nobug] Deal with missing options arg in Bramble.load()
2015-06-18 23:09:27 -04:00
David Humphrey (:humph) david.humphrey@senecacollege.ca
f89e9a3330
Remote MessageChannel filesystem working everywhere but Firefox
...
Trying to get Firefox to work, not there yet
Firefox working
Always call port.start() when using addEventListener
Everything working well for binary and utf8 data across browsers
Removed kamino.js, which we don't use for our MessageChannel shim.
Update README for hosted.html details
Use minified Filer in hosted.js
Use transferable, except in Blink
Add test for safe transfer of ArrayBuffer over MessageChannel (buggy in Chrome, possibly IE, Safari)
Fixes for jshint
Add fs.unlink and fs.rmdir, fix use of stats.isDirectory()
Rework remote callbacks for watch events
Go back to async blob url management
Remove debugger statement in BlobUtils
Break up BracketsFiler into RemoteFiler for circular ref fix (Path loading still wrong), mostly working
Working
Fix ownership of Path and Buffer, move to FilerUtils.js
Cache CSS files
Fix circular ref between BlobUtils and Handlers, move caching to FilerFileSystem
Fix small typos
Go back to async blob url management
Working iframe api
Make URL configurable, default to prod
Pass provider to Filer correctly
Add remote command layer
JSHint fixes after rebase
Hook-up mobile and desktop preview modes
Add stand-alone build step for bramble iframe api
Fix jshint for almond.js
Add some other common methods, add async handling for focus change
s/createInstance/getInstance/
Added docs to README on iframe api
Fixup styling in README
Update README for fs vs. fs()
Add showStatusbar() and hideStatusbar() with statusbar off by default
Fix review issues: option for using location.search from host, removed mime arg in HTMLRewriter
Don't try to minify node_modules in extensions/extra (breaking Jordan's build with MDNDocs)
Fix grunt/jshint/requirejs bugs related to build-browser, add loading spinner
Fix to README for dist/ method of using Bramble
Fix DOMContentLoaded issue and document.readyState
API state and events working
Updated docs, extra getters on API
Remove reference to passing provider to getInstance()
Reworking API for .load() and .mount(), sort of working
Everything working with load() and mount()
Update docs for load() and mount()
Fix typos in readme
Update docs, change readyState management, deal with rel/abs paths to mount()
Fix typo, update hosted.html to work with new api
Show sidebar if project file count > 1
Add fileChange, fileRename, and fileDelete events on bramble
Make sure first-pane has focus on startup, so text size +/- commands work
Missing semicolon
Get rid of callbacks on Bramble.mount()
Fix startup order so secondPaneWidth is known on ready, fix typo in README
jshint fix
2015-06-17 15:22:52 -04:00
David Humphrey
726b6127ca
Merge pull request #348 from humphd/issue338
...
Fix #338 : Remove unnecessary calls to the filesystem during initial load of brackets
2015-06-08 10:54:32 -04:00
David Humphrey (:humph) david.humphrey@senecacollege.ca
9c74998993
Fix #338 : Remove unnecessary calls to the filesystem during initial load of brackets
2015-06-08 10:42:15 -04:00
Kieran Sedgwick
e520608142
Fixed #334 - Hook up brackets theme switching to postMessage transport
2015-06-05 12:32:17 -04:00
Jordan Theriault
27d464e5f5
Merge pull request #339 from JordanTheriault/html-webplatformdocs
...
Updated WebplatformDocs to Marcel Gerber's html-docs branch
2015-06-05 09:48:32 -04:00
JordanTheriault
d744db386b
Updated Webplatform docs to integrate Marcel Gerbers html-docs, modified to work with Bramble
2015-06-05 09:38:37 -04:00
Jordan Theriault
259f2c1484
Merge pull request #343 from JordanTheriault/mdn-docs-extension
...
Added MDN docs extension
2015-06-04 16:29:47 -04:00
JordanTheriault
d7b6e669ba
Added MDN docs extension
2015-06-04 16:20:15 -04:00
Gideon Thomas
2f9ab593d3
Fix mozilla/thimble.webmaker.org#548 - Changes don't take effect when typing in the style tag
2015-06-04 15:32:38 -04:00
Jordan Theriault
0ae036b32c
Merge pull request #346 from JordanTheriault/urlCallbackFix
...
openURLInDefaultBrowser callback fix
2015-06-04 10:33:56 -04:00